Stripe Terminal At a Glance

Stripe Terminal is built with a developer in mind. While the coding required isn’t very extensive, it is more than a general layperson can do without help. You may find a third-party integration easier if you can’t code it yourself, although that will usually require a monthly charge.

While there are no monthly fees, Stripe Terminal does charge a standard credit card processing fee of 2.7% plus 5 cents per successful card transaction. If your business processes a larger volume of payments, contact the sales department for custom pricing. In addition to the per-transaction fees, you must also purchase a pre-certified card reader.

Hardware options include the following:

  • BBPOS WisePOS E
  • BBPOS Chipper 2X BT
  • WisePad3
  • Verifone P400
  • Stripe Reader M2

If a customer makes a purchase online, they can pick it up in-store. Stripe provides a software development kit (SDK) that makes it simple to include into your own mobile and web applications, resulting in a unique in-store checkout experience.


Other Benefits

With Stripe Terminal integration, you can track all of your online and off-line transactions in one place, making reporting and reconciliation easier. Terminal works with Stripe Payments, Connect and Billing—so you can send invoices, set up subscriptions and receive payment for products and services. With its centralized fleet management solutions, you may efficiently manage in-person payments as your business grows.

You can order EMV-certified hardware directly from Stripe, so your business has fraud protection. Its hardware accepts chip cards and contactless payments like Apple Pay and Google Pay, although some reviews say it doesn’t always work the greatest.

Your first payout can take up to ten business days, but after that, it’s a standard two-business-day wait to get your funds. For a 1% fee of the payout amount, you can get access to your funds immediately with Instant Payouts.

To receive your payouts within minutes, you must have an eligible debit card for the funds to transfer to. This means you can access your money 24/7—including evenings, weekends and holidays. There are daily payout limits, so check your dashboard for yours. As your business grows, so can your limit.


Fine Print

Don’t expect to have your Stripe Terminal ready to use the moment you sign up. First and foremost, it’s a developer-friendly tool; if you lack developer experience, you will have difficulty setting this up without help.

Some users complain about their funds getting held for an indefinite amount of time while their account is in review. This is helpful when there are fraud issues, but for other businesses without these issues, it can put them in a bind to wait for payment.

Lightspeed and eHopper POS are easier to use than the Stripe Terminal. However, a developer can completely customize the terminal to make your own checkout experience, whereas the other two POS systems aren’t as flexible. Each of these systems allows software integrations to help expand functionality. With Stripe Terminal being relatively new to the in-person retail scene, there aren’t as many integrations as eHopper and Lightspeed, although an open API could change that quickly.


Is Stripe Terminal Right for Your Business?

If you’re a developer or employ one, you’ll love Stripe Terminal thanks to its flexible API. Otherwise, you’ll need to spend some time getting acquainted with the setup. This terminal is best for online-first retailers who already know and like Stripe’s e-commerce features.


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can a restaurant use Stripe Terminal?

Technically, through apps and extensions, a restaurant can use Stripe Terminal. However, there are better options that give restaurants more features and control.

I run a multilevel marketing (MLM) retail store. Can I use Stripe Terminal?

No, Stripe Terminal prohibits MLMs. They consider MLMs to be consistently troublesome.

Is Stripe Terminal secure?

Yes. Stripe Terminal offers all the security features you’d expect out of a modern POS system such as PCI compliance, single sign-on (SSO) and fraud detection measures.

Can I accept preorders with Stripe Terminal?

That depends. If you plan on processing a large number of preorders, it’s best to get in touch with Stripe first. However, one-off preorders aren’t usually a problem.
